Your Next Stamp & Craft us Crazy


I'm honored to be guest designing for Craft Us Crazy on behalf of Your Next Stamp who is a sponsor of the current challenge...
~ Mom's and Flowers ~  

Now you aren't required to incorporate both themes for the challenge to enter, but I was able to by using this happy little flower, Dixie Daisy.  This image was part of the March YNS release and I LOVE it and couldn't wait to create with it!!  I've used DP from My Mind's Eye, Fine and Dandy which begged to be paired with kraft cardstock.  The kraft cardstock was embossed with the Swiss Dots embossing folder.   The paper panels were all machine stitched and I used tiny champagne colored heart rhinestones for a simple yet sparkly accent.  The jumbo sized ric rac was made using Papertrey Ink's die and cream colored felt.  The image was stamped on Vintage Cream cardstock and for fun I stamped the image again and popped the eyes up with foam tape for dimension.  The petals were given a sparkle treatment by using my mixture of Shimmerz and Stickles.

I couldn't wait to play along.  The second I saw Meljen's, Yeti Cocoa I was excited to get the chance to make a hot chocolate pouch holder like I had been wanting.

Winter is almost non existent here in Florida but if it's even the tiniest bit cold outside I find that's the perfect excuse to make hot chocolate.  My favorite thing about winter is enjoying a mug of piping hot chocolate while sitting outside by our fire pit in the evenings.  And if we sit by the fire, the kids have to roast marshmallows.  Brooke likes to dunk hers in my hot chocolate and Nathan...well he just likes setting his on fire, LOL.   


I've used My Time Made Easy, Cutesy Cover template (it's FREE) for my holder.  It is the perfect size for my packets of hot chocolate...Swiss Miss Milk Chocolate!!  :)

I've tried coloring this adorable Yeti using the "flick" technique with my Copics to resemble fur.  I REALLY need some serious practice with this!!  The only thing I accomplished was making him look like a hairy elf in need of a shave!!  LOL   But I just LOVE those big feet, don't you?!?!?
